Developing durable tracking systems that can establish unified user profiles throughout gadgets is a major obstacle. Consumers frequently begin a journey on one device, after that switch over to one more to complete it, resulting in fragmented accounts and incorrect information.

Deterministic cross-device acknowledgment designs can overcome this trouble by sewing individuals together making use of understood, definitive identifiers like an e-mail address or cookie ID. Nevertheless, this method isn't fail-safe and relies on customers being visited on every gadget. In addition, data personal privacy laws such as GDPR and CCPA make it tough to track users without their consent. This makes relying on probabilistic monitoring methods a lot more complex. The good news is, methods such as incrementality testing can aid marketing professionals overcome these difficulties. They enable them to acquire an extra accurate image of the consumer journey, allowing them to optimize ROI on their paid advertising projects.

4. Scalability
Unlike single-device attribution, which counts on internet cookies, cross-device acknowledgment calls for linked individual IDs to track touchpoints and conversions. Without this, individuals' information is fragmented, and marketing professionals can not precisely analyze marketing performance.

Identity resolution tools like deterministic tracking or probabilistic matching help online marketers link device-level data to one-of-a-kind customer accounts. Nonetheless, these approaches call for that customers be visited to all tools and systems, which is usually not practical for mobile customers. In addition, personal privacy conformity guidelines such as GDPR and CCPA limit these monitoring abilities.

Fortunately is that alternate techniques are addressing this difficulty. AI-powered attribution models, for example, leverage vast datasets to reveal nuanced patterns and disclose surprise understandings within complicated multi-device journeys. By utilizing these innovations, online marketers can develop much more scalable and precise cross-device attribution solutions.
